Addressing Intersectionality and Systemic Barriers

The redefined approach to rehabilitation also recognizes the complex intersections of identities and the systemic barriers that may lessen an individualu2019s access to care. Factors such as race, ethnicity, gender identity, sexual orientation, disability status, and socioeconomic background can influence an individualu2019s experiences and perspectives, as well as their ability to navigate the healthcare system.
